Alison’s Occupational Therapy and Case Management experience includes working with young people and adults with complex needs and disabilities acquired through life changing incidents, birth trauma or medical negligence. Alison has previously supported clients with acquired brain injury as a support worker (since 2009) and team leader as well as now being a qualified Occupational Therapist. Alison works closely with the adult or young person and their family and actively advocates for her clients and their families. She is involved in the recruitment and retention of therapy and support teams. Her OT role looks at person centred rehabilitation goals as well as advice on housing adaptations or requirements. Skills include money management, travel training, cooking and shopping skills, independent living skills and accessing education or employment.

Alison is registered with the HCPC and is a Registered Practitioner member of BABICM. She is also a member of RCOT, RCOTSS-IP and RCOTSS-CYPF.
